虚拟机中实现VPN拨号的完整配置指南与网络优化策略

banxian11 2026-04-16 免费VPN 4 0

在现代企业网络架构中,虚拟化技术已成为提升资源利用率和灵活性的核心手段,而随着远程办公需求的增长,通过虚拟机(VM)连接到公司内网或访问特定资源的场景越来越普遍。“虚拟机VPN拨号”成为许多网络工程师日常工作中必须掌握的技术之一,本文将详细介绍如何在主流虚拟化平台(如VMware Workstation、VirtualBox或Hyper-V)中为虚拟机配置并成功拨号接入VPN,同时提供性能调优建议,确保虚拟机环境下的网络稳定性和安全性。

明确前提条件:你需要一个可用的VPN服务(如OpenVPN、IPsec或Windows自带的PPTP/L2TP),以及具备管理员权限的虚拟机操作系统(通常为Windows Server或Linux发行版),以Linux为例,在Ubuntu虚拟机中配置OpenVPN拨号时,需先安装openvpn客户端工具:

sudo apt update && sudo apt install openvpn -y

将从IT部门获取的.ovpn配置文件复制到虚拟机指定目录(如/etc/openvpn/client.conf),然后使用以下命令启动拨号:

sudo openvpn --config /etc/openvpn/client.conf

此时若提示“Authentication failed”,请检查证书、用户名密码是否正确;若出现“Cannot resolve host”,则说明DNS未正确配置,可手动添加DNS服务器地址至/etc/resolv.conf

对于Windows虚拟机用户,可通过“路由和远程访问”功能配置PPTP或L2TP/IPsec连接,操作步骤如下:打开“网络和共享中心” → “设置新的连接或网络” → 选择“连接到工作场所” → 输入VPN服务器地址及凭据,关键点在于:确保虚拟机的网络适配器模式为“桥接”或“NAT”,避免因网络隔离导致无法访问外部资源。

常见问题排查包括:

  1. 虚拟机无法获取IP地址:检查虚拟机网络适配器是否启用DHCP;
  2. 拨号后无法访问内网:确认路由表是否正确添加子网段(用route -n查看);
  3. 速度缓慢:建议在主机端启用硬件加速(如Intel VT-d或AMD-Vi),并调整虚拟机内存分配。

安全层面不容忽视,应在虚拟机中启用防火墙规则(如ufw或Windows Defender Firewall),限制不必要的入站/出站流量,定期更新虚拟机操作系统补丁,并对敏感数据加密存储,防止中间人攻击。

性能优化方面,推荐:

  • 使用SR-IOV或DPDK等高性能网络接口技术;
  • 避免在同一宿主机上运行多个高负载虚拟机;
  • 启用虚拟机快照功能,便于快速回滚故障状态。

虚拟机中的VPN拨号不仅提升了远程接入的灵活性,也要求工程师具备扎实的网络基础和系统管理能力,通过合理配置、持续监控与安全加固,我们能在保障效率的同时,构建更可靠的虚拟化网络环境。

虚拟机中实现VPN拨号的完整配置指南与网络优化策略

半仙加速器-海外加速器|VPN加速器|vpn翻墙加速器|VPN梯子|VPN外网加速